Located in Ponce, Puerto Rico, this museum stands as a tribute to Francisco "Pancho" Coimbre, a pioneering figure in the world of baseball and a symbol of cultural pride. Originating from the mid-20th century, the museum encapsulates the essence of Coimbre's illustrious career and his impact on baseball, both locally and globally.

The Museo Francisco "Pancho" Coimbre takes visitors on an enlightening journey through the life and times of a man many consider a trailblazer in Puerto Rican sports. Who was Pancho Coimbre? Born in 1909, Francisco Coimbre was a baseball legend, playing during a period when the sport was becoming a passionate pastime in Latin America. His talents took him across the globe, breaking racial barriers and showcasing the prowess of Puerto Rican athletes.
